About Shijun Huang
Shijun Huang is a scholar working on Ocean Engineering, Mechanical Engineering and Analytical Chemistry, having authored 104 papers that have together received 1.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hydraulic Fracturing and Reservoir Analysis (53 papers), Enhanced Oil Recovery Techniques (50 papers) and Reservoir Engineering and Simulation Methods (47 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ocean Engineering (1.3k citations), Analytical Chemistry (306 citations) and Mechanical Engineering (996 citations). Shijun Huang has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Linsong Cheng, Pin Jia, Meng Cao, Hao Liu, Linsong Cheng, Hao Gu, Hao Xiong, Yonghui Wu, Changhao Hu and Mingzhe Dong.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Hazardous Materials, Applied Catalysis B: Environmental and Chemical Engineering Journal.
